Two Fullerton Players Taken in Baseball Draft
Two members of the Fullerton College baseball team were taken in the Major League Baseball amateur draft, which concluded Friday, Fullerton Coach Nick Fuscardo said Friday.
Alan Newman, a freshman pitcher, was selected in the second round by the Minnesota Twins. Deryk Hudson, a freshman third baseman, was taken by the Pittsburgh Pirates in the 11th round.
